Introduction to WhatsApp Business API
The WhatsApp Business API is designed for medium and large businesses to communicate with their customers on WhatsApp. It offers advanced features for sending notifications, handling customer inquiries, and automating interactions. Setting up this API requires careful planning and a few essential steps to ensure smooth integration.
Step 1: Prepare Your Business Information
Before creating an API account, businesses need to gather specific information. This includes verifying the company’s identity and having a clear understanding of how the API will be used. Businesses must provide details such as their legal business name, website, and contact information.
Step 2: Apply for Access to WhatsApp Business API
The next step is to apply for access to the WhatsApp Business API. This process typically involves filling out an application form through the WhatsApp Business website. Businesses must provide the required information and wait for approval. This step ensures that legitimate and verified businesses use the API.
Step 3: Choose a Service Provider
Once approved, businesses need to choose a service provider to help integrate the WhatsApp Business API into their systems. Providers like MSG91 offer comprehensive solutions for managing API access and integrating it with existing systems. Selecting a reliable provider ensures a smooth setup and ongoing support.
Step 4: Set Up Your WhatsApp Business Profile
After choosing a provider, the next step is to set up the WhatsApp Business profile. This involves configuring the business phone number, creating a profile name, and setting up business hours. A well-crafted profile helps establish credibility and provides essential information to customers.
Step 5: Verify Your Business and Phone Number
Verification is a crucial step in the setup process. Businesses must verify their phone number to use the WhatsApp Business API. This usually involves receiving a verification code via SMS or a phone call. Completing this verification ensures that the phone number is associated with the business and ready for use.
Step 6: Integrate the API with Your Systems
Integration is the core of setting up the WhatsApp Business API. Businesses need to connect the API with their customer relationship management (CRM) systems or other platforms. This step enables businesses to send messages, manage conversations, and automate responses effectively.

Step 7: Test and Launch
Before going live, businesses should thoroughly test the WhatsApp Business API setup. This includes sending test messages, checking automated responses, and ensuring that all features work as expected. Testing helps identify and resolve any issues before launching the API for customer interactions.
Step 8: Monitor and Optimize
After launching, ongoing monitoring is essential. Businesses should track performance metrics such as message delivery rates, response times, and customer engagement. Regular analysis helps businesses understand how effectively they are using the API and make necessary adjustments to improve communication.
